Genetic diversity and phylogenetic relationships of bacteria belonging to the Ochrobactrum-Brucella group by recA and 16S rRNA gene-based comparative sequence analysis.
Systematic and applied microbiology - 1 Mar 2008
Scholz Holger C, Al Dahouk Sascha, Tomaso Herbert, Neubauer Heinrich, Witte Angela, Schloter Michael, Kämpfer Peter, Falsen Enevold, Pfeffer Martin, Engel Marion
Abstract excerpt
The genetic diversity and phylogenetic interrelationships among 106 Ochrobactrum strains (O. anthropi: 72, O. intermedium: 22, O. tritici: 5, O. oryzae: 2, O. grignonense: 2, O. gallinifaecis: 1, O. lupini: 2), the type strains of the eight Brucella species and other closely related taxa were stu...
